This Beast is Great
By wingrider | on Saturday, May 18, 2019
We quickly nicknamed our truck "The Beast". Have had it for 2yrs. It is very comfortable, very quiet, has a well laid out dashboard with easy to read gauges. I've been pulling our 8,000 RV trailer and have gone from Prince Edward Island to Nevada... if I didn't look in the rearview mirror I'd never know I was pulling the trailer. Excellent brakes and good handling. So far my only complaint is the ridiculous place GM put the DEF fluid intake - its in the engine compartment next to the firewall, nearly impossible to fill with out spilling DEF. It could use more storage space for tools... but that's about it. Its a tough powerful truck.…
